Established Goals:
Colonization and Conflict: 1607 through the American Revolution
VS.3 The student will demonstrate an understanding of the first permanent English settlement in
America by
a) explaining the reasons for English colonization;
b) describing the economic and geographic influences on the decision to settle at
Jamestown; and
c) describing the importance of the charters of the Virginia Company of London in
establishing the Jamestown settlement.

STAGE 3 – LEARNING PLAN


Summary of Learning Activities:

1. Hook: Show a picture of Jamestown, and ask the students what they see, think, and wonder about the
picture.
2. Introduce: VDOE VS3. A, B, C. (have the student know and understand what they are learning in
the unit.
3. Establish the goals for the unit and what the students need to get out of the unit and things they
might want to learn more about.
4. Identify the different terms: Jamestown, charter, settlers, etc.
5. Introduce VDOE VS3. a.
6. TTW show students Jamestown Virginia and how it looked before colonization.
7. Popcorn read: the students will take turns reading and then calling on someone else after reading a
section or two. The reading will help explain the reasons for English colonization, and then have
discussion about what the students read.
8. Discuss how the trip was funded and why Jamestown was chosen as the location to settle.
9. Exit ticket: 3, 2, and 1(3 things learned, 2 interesting facts, 1 question). Have the students write
down three things they learn, 2 facts they found interesting, and one question they have.
10. KWL: What a student knows, wants to learn, and what a student learned.
11. Video: (https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=qQH-JWOH2Xs).
12. Journals: notes on the video that is above.
